## Local Setup

Spokeflow plugins run against a local dock-state database. Install deps with `make deps`, then seed fixtures with `make seed` — this loads sample stations and fleet counts. Plugins register via the manifest file; no rebuild needed. Point your local instance at the seeded database using the connection string below.

database URL for haduf-tajof: redis://holox_svc:c9@db-3fb6.lumicworks.local:5432/fraeth

Handover: Schema Registry (Eventline)

Hey Priya — wrapping up my rotation on Eventline's schema registry before the sync. Compatibility checks are now enforced on publish, and the legacy v1 namespace is frozen. Watch the retention job; it ran long twice last week. The consumer team at Brightloom is migrating Thursday, so expect a spike in lookups. Everything you need to run it locally is below.

config for kawip-kageg:
[noviel]
team = tamwyn
access_code = ac_880361
owner = quenvan.wenax
host = noviel.norvaio.internal
port = 11211
peer = fraox.tolvaqhq.local
salt = 41e02253
pin = 6434

Handover for the Bramleyfort password reset revamp. The new flow replaces emailed links with short-lived codes; rate limiting lives in ResetGate middleware, and token hashing moved to the Larkspur helper. Tests cover expiry, reuse, and enumeration. Outstanding: the audit-log event names need review before merge, and the staging feature flag is still off. To unlock the shared credentials vault for the staging run, the recovery passphrase is below.

vault phrase of yadup-hahog = kasax-goriel-olidor-novmir-istax-olimir-sorys-olimir-holeth-aldeth-ralax-zordor-ralion-wenax

Subject: Tide widget key rotation

Hey — quick heads-up before you review my PR for the Saltmere tide-table widget. The old prediction-service key got rotated this morning, so the fixtures now use the new one. Nothing else changed in the auth flow. For local testing, the current key is below.

API key for yahig-tadup: kto7_ubizbYm